20th Edition Prices;

1972 $5 BC-48bT Prefix RS: Unc. $6250, CUnc. $6500, GUnc. $7000

1979 $5  BC-53aT: Unc. $5000, CUnc. $5200, GUnc. $5500

OK, Here are the 21st edition prices  ;)

BC-48bT: 1972 R/S Test Note = Unc: $5,600 C.Unc: $5,900 G.Unc: $6,500

BC-53aT: 1979 "33" Test Note = Unc: $5,000 C.Unc: $5,200 G.Unc: $5,500
